- SAN FRANCISCO — Today the California Supreme Court handed a huge victory to the millions of California voters who passed Proposition 22 and oppose same-sex "marriage." The court ruled 7-0 that the mayor and county clerk of San Francisco exceeded their authority when they defied state law and issued "marriage" licenses to same-sex couples. The court also ruled 5-2 that because San Francisco issued the licenses illegally, they are invalid. - MADISON, WI— This past Friday was a day to remember for Captain Scott Southworth, a unit commander in the Wisconsin National Guard 32nd Military Police Company. Southworth’s unit returned on Friday from more than a year of rigorous duty in Iraq and the United States Court of Appeals for the 7th Circuit handed down the latest opinion in Southworth v. Board of Regents of the University of Wisconsin System. Captain Southworth, then a student at the University of Wisconsin, was the plaintiff in the lawsuit when it was filed in 1996.
